t's often dismissed as a cliche to motivate dieters. But it appears there may be some truth to the adage ‘a moment on the lips, a lifetime on the hips’. Once eaten, fat is stored on the waistline within hours, say scientists – far faster than previously thought.

In fact, a more accurate saying would be: ‘A moment on the lips, three hours later on the midriff.’ Within just three or four hours of having a meal, up to two or three teaspoons of fat have from the food have been stored there. Eat again shortly afterwards and the fat stores around the middle will grow and grow.
